首页
外语
计算机
考研
公务员
职业资格
财经
工程
司法
医学
专升本
自考
实用职业技能
登录
计算机
数据库中事务的并发操作可能会引起死锁,引起死锁的原因是不同事务对数据项的资源占有,导致其他事务不能得到资源,从而引起相互等待导致死锁。假设某数据库系统中存在一个等待事务集{T1,T2,13,T4,T5},其中T1正在等待被T2锁住的数据项A2,T2正在等待
数据库中事务的并发操作可能会引起死锁,引起死锁的原因是不同事务对数据项的资源占有,导致其他事务不能得到资源,从而引起相互等待导致死锁。假设某数据库系统中存在一个等待事务集{T1,T2,13,T4,T5},其中T1正在等待被T2锁住的数据项A2,T2正在等待
admin
2021-09-16
86
问题
数据库中事务的并发操作可能会引起死锁,引起死锁的原因是不同事务对数据项的资源占有,导致其他事务不能得到资源,从而引起相互等待导致死锁。假设某数据库系统中存在一个等待事务集{T1,T2,13,T4,T5},其中T1正在等待被T2锁住的数据项A2,T2正在等待被T4锁住的数据项A4,T3正在等待被T4锁住的数据项A4,T5正在等待被T1锁住的数据项A。则关于系统状态正确的是( )。
选项
A、系统处于死锁状态,需要撤销其中任意一个事务即可退出死锁状态
B、系统处于死锁状态,通过撤销T4可使系统退出死锁状态
C、系统处于死锁状态,通过撤销T5可使系统退出死锁状态
D、系统未处于死锁状态,不需要撤销其中的任何事务
答案
D
解析
从下面的资源图可知,系统没有资源死锁环,事务T4完成后释放A4,T2完成后释放A2,T1完成后释放T5,所有事务即可正常结束。
转载请注明原文地址:https://kaotiyun.com/show/wFeZ777K
本试题收录于:
三级数据库技术题库NCRE全国计算机三级分类
0
三级数据库技术
NCRE全国计算机三级
相关试题推荐
下列条目中,哪些属于将SQL嵌入主语言使用时必须解决的问题? I.区分SQL语句与主语言语句 II.动态生成的SQL语句 III.数据库工作单元和程序工作单元之间的通信 IV.协调SQL语句与主语言语句处理记录的不同方式
在数据库技术中,对数据库进行备份,这主要是为了维护数据库的
在数据库系统中有一类人员,负责监控数据库系统的运行情况,及时处理运行过程中出现的问题,这类人员是
在页式存储管理中,为进行地址转换工作,系统提供一对硬件寄存器,它们是
在数据库中,产生数据不一致的根本原因是()。A)数据存储量过大B)缺乏数据保护机制C)数据冗余D)缺乏数据安全性控制
下列关于SQL语言的叙述中,哪一条是不正确的?()A)SQL语言支持数据库的三级模式结构B)一个基本表只能存储在一个存储文件中C)一个SQL表可以是一个基本表或者是个视图D)存储文件的逻辑结构组成了关系数据库的内模式
A、 B、 C、 D、 C创建索引(index)是加快表的查询速度的有效手段。视图是从一个或几个基本表(或其它视图)中导出的表,是一个虚表。可以简化用户的操作、是用户从多种角度观察同一个数据库,对重
A、 B、 C、 D、 C数据库查询是数据库操作的核心。SQL语言提供了SELECT语句进行数据库的查询,该语句的一般格式是:SELECT[ALL|DISTINCT]<目标列表达式>[,<目标列表达
A、 B、 C、 D、 A有两种错误可能造成事务故障:逻辑错误和系统错误。系统故障是指硬件故障或者是数据库软件或操作系统的漏洞,导致系统停止运行。主存储器内容丢失,而外存储器仍完好无损。磁盘故障是指在数据传送
随机试题
患儿,5岁,以单纯性肾病收入院,发病3天来阴囊水肿明显,局部皮肤紧张、变薄、透亮,尿蛋白定性(++++),治疗使用强的松,针对该表现,护理诊断为( )。
A.养心B.渗湿C.温胃D.益阴E.温阳参苓白术散除益气健脾、止泻外,还具有的功用是
燥湿化痰,理气止咳适用于清肝泻肺,化痰止咳适用于
下列各项中,不属于自制原始凭证的是()。
2012年1月,李某设立了甲一人有限责任公司(下称甲公司),注册资本为550万元。2013年1月,甲公司向乙银行借款500万元,双方签订了借款合同,借款期限为2年。陈某在借款合同中以保证人身份签字。借款合同包含如下仲裁条款:凡是与本借款债务清偿有关的纠纷
从决策的基本属性来看,决策是()。
下列属于期刊分类的是()。
WhenPaulGorski,thefounderofanorganizationcalledEdChange,visitscollegesanduniversitiestoadvisethemoncampusdive
聚集是一种()措施。
支持子程序调用的数据结构是()。
最新回复
(
0
)